My amber suspension fault light is coming on. What should I do? I have a 2006 Range Rover Sport. How long do I have before anything serious happens?
Optional Information: Year: 2006Make: LandRoverModel: Range RoverEngine: V8
Hi, Thanks for using JustAnswer.
Well this light is indicating a fault in your system, If you dont have any air leaks (not common) then you should be able to continue driving the vechicle for a week or so with no problems other than the air suspension will not adjust. But if you do have a small air leak then the vechicle could lower to its bump stops in which case you will probably require a tow, since driving it in this state would be very uncomfortable and a bit dangerous.
If your Range Rover Sport is supercharged or has the dynamic responce sway bar system this light can also indicate faults with this system, In which case the sway bar becomes "locked" and you wont quite have the same handling performance as usual, but the vechicle will be safe to drive (basicly you will not get the high performance corning cababilites that this system controls)

What do I need to have done in particularly? My question is what should i have replaced?
Ahh well first thing will be to have the fault codes read, for that it will take a dealer or a specialist Land Rover repair shop. The system is monitoring soo many different things that I cant tell you what to repair without the faults.
What you could do and sometimes happens is if you battery has started to fail (does not properly hold a charge) this alone can tho many types of faults since the computer systems monitor battery voltage. So a quick trip to an Autozone and they will test your battery for free and replace it if needed. This is where I would start if you dont want to take it to a shop at this time and maybe all that is required.
